Output e823bfedbb38c70663f322ddbbbeafbf360b6a4204df005d7b60acf153f56f89:12

value
16978676
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5d36c42e5e008ce7e220f95e94d87bb89c4fa957 OP_EQUAL
address
MGQ2gW4gHi5dJjyAq4bFbcumwRZj87vjFW
transaction
e823bfedbb38c70663f322ddbbbeafbf360b6a4204df005d7b60acf153f56f89
spent
true